In the wake of the devastating collapse of the Champlain Towers South Condominium in Surfside, Florida, many current owners and potential purchasers of condominium units are, understandably, requesting information from associations regarding the structural soundness of the condominium property. Although associations generally do not, and are not required to, release their official records to potential purchasers, they are obligated by Florida law to maintain and provide certain records and documents to owners upon request.
